SUM除以两个小区的结果(SUMPRODUCT但除法代替)(SUM the result of di

2019-08-03 09:24发布

我希望做的相当于SUMPRODUCT但分工。 有没有办法从分两个数组添加的结果?

例如:柱A在几年的资产的“生命” (10, 20, 10) 塔B的资产的价值(10,000, 20,000, 20,000) 我要添加的结果(10,000/10) + (20,000/20) + (20,000/10) = 4,000 ,而对于式是动态的,因为我添加具有寿命和值的行。

提前致谢。

Answer 1:

由于该师是乘法相反,您可以使用此:

= SUMPRODUCT(1 / A1:A3,B1:B3)



Answer 2:

你可以做到这一点与这个公式

=SUMPRODUCT(B2:B10/A2:A10)

没有空格或零列允许的范围...

编辑:错过了动态部分....无论是使用动态命名范围....或者您可以使用此数组版本允许多达1000行,其中后来者都是空白

=SUM(IF(A2:A1000<>0,B2:B1000/A2:A1000))

确诊CTRL+SHIFT+ENTER



Answer 3:

其实最好的公式是这样的一种:

=SUMPRODUCT(SUM(E2:E10))/(SUM(D2:10))

您还可以用另一个类似下面结合公式:

=SUMPRODUCT(SUM(E2:10))/(count(D2:D10))

祝好运



文章来源: SUM the result of dividing two cells (SUMPRODUCT but division instead)